"The Akumaito Beam" is the one hundred and fourth chapter of the Dragon Ball manga series by Akira Toriyama. It was first published in Japan in the 1987 #03/04 issue of Shueisha's Weekly Shōnen Jump.
Summary
Goku thinks this one is not all that strong either, and Akkuman gets pissed. The Fortuneteller Crone yells at him to hurry up with it, and so Akkuman comes at Goku again. He swipes at him, but Goku leans back, and then jumps backwards to avoid his kick. Goku then runs at Akkuman and punches him in the face, knocking out a tooth, and knocking him off the tongue. Akkuman starts flapping his wings, though, and gets back up there and starts bragging about how great "Akkuman-sama" is.
Everyone is happy with Goku's match, saying his opponent looks like no big deal, but the Turtle Hermit says Akkuman is a two-time champion of the Tenka'ichi Budōkai. The Crone yells at Akkuman for slacking off so much, and so he decides to show his true power. Akkuman puts his two index and two middle fingers to his head, and talks about how this technique will make your heart explode if you have even a little bit of evil in it. He tells Goku he is going to die, and pulls his fingers from his head and points them at Goku. The Crone calls out for him to wait, but it is too late, the attack has started. A wave comes from his fingers, swirling its way towards Goku and it hits him.
Akkuman calls out for Goku to explode, and everyone is worried about him, but Goku just wonders about this weird light that is surrounding him. It disappears, and the Crone says this kid has a heart like a baby or an animal. Everyone is happy Goku is all right, and Akkuman gets pissed and makes a pitchfork appear. He swipes at Goku with it, and Goku gets mad about him using a weapon. Goku gets serious and kicks Akkuman through one of the devils' heads and into the wall. He thinks he might have put a little too much into it. The Turtle Hermit cannot believe Goku's speed.
